Active Listings Have Lost Color Codes i.e. Green = Bid, Red = No Bids
So when I go to look at my auctions the price section is no longer showing color (Red, Green) indicating no bid or bid. It is all just black text. Is it just me?

wastingtime101
·1 year agoHi @chubbycatcollectibles . eBay changed Seller Hub navigation for active listings which includes removing the summary and changing all prices to black.
You can customize your active listings table, add the "bids" column to your view, then sort your listings by number of bids by clicking on the column header. That will give you a clear view of which auctions have bids and which don't.
